While the USB source is active,
use the following to operate
USB function:
k
(Play/Pause): Press to start,
pause or resume play of the current
media source.
l
(Seek Up/FWD): Press to seek
to the next track.
Press and hold to advance quickly
through playback. Release the
button to return to playing speed.
Elapsed time displays.
g
(Seek Down/REV): Press to
seek to the beginning of the current
or previous track. If the track
has been playing for less than
five seconds, the previous track
plays. If playing longer than
five seconds, the current track
restarts. Press and hold to reverse
quickly through playback. Release
the button to return to playing speed.
Elapsed time displays.
TUNE: Turn the knob to the right or
left to go to the next or previous
track.
USB Music Menu: See USB Music
Menu following for more information.

USB Music Menu

Once the USB has been connected,
the main music menu appears.
Select any of the following buttons
on the USB Music Menu:
Files/Folders/Playlists: Select to
view the playlists stored on the USB.
Select a folder/playlist to view a
list of all songs in the folder/playlist.
Select a song from the list. Once
selected, Files/Folders/Playlists
Mode displays. The playlist option
would only be available if the device
has playlist.
